How to Get a kia sorento keyless entry replacement kia car keys Key

Kia cars come with an immobiliser system that is designed to guard against theft. The key has the transponder, which transmits a coded message to the vehicle. It will only start when the right key is used.

Cost

The cost of a new kia replacement key can be costly. There are ways to reduce the cost. You can purchase a second-hand car key from a dealer, and then program it at an automotive locksmith. You can also inquire with your insurance company whether they offer this service. You'll save money and time. You can also get the key in a local garage. This could be more expensive and will take longer.

You should also consider the type of key you have (chip, intelligent fob, remote, push-to start, or regular non-transponder key). The more technologically advanced keys are and the more expensive you can expect to pay for replacement. You may also inquire with your dealer if there are any special deals or promotions.

If you are buying a new key from a dealer, be sure to bring a spare key along with any other documents to prove that you are the owner of the vehicle. This is because they'll need to verify you are the owner before cutting the new key. The dealer's code won't work if the ignition has been changed in the past. This could prevent the new key from functioning.

You could also ask the dealer for the original if you have an older model. However, if your vehicle is older than 10 years, the dealer will not keep a record of it and you'll need to go to an automotive locksmith instead.

Time is a major factor.

If you've lost your key The quickest method to replace it is at the dealer where you purchased your car. You'll need your driver's licence and evidence of ownership documents. The dealer will order the new key and then pair it electronically to your vehicle. This process can take several weeks. Another option is using an mobile locksmith who can visit your location and manufacture a key for your Kia immediately. They can also program the new key to start, lock, and unlock the vehicle.

The majority of Kia models have the smart key or remote/fob key. The keys have an transponder chip that needs to be programmed to begin the car. The chips that are used in these keys range between 1995 and 2000. They are referred to as Texas crypto 4D type 13 or T5.

You may also need a new battery for your key fob. The most common battery for Kia remotes is the CR2032 lithium battery. They are available at most automotive stores. Make sure to remove the old battery, and keep it in a safe location.

You'll pay around 10 to 15 percent less for a new key from the dealer than you would from an auto locksmith. You'll have to pay for towing costs to the dealer, and wait until they program the key. In addition, you'll have to wait until the shop opens when you call outside business hours. Locksmiths are a reasonable and convenient choice.

Security

Car thefts pose a serious concern for many people. There are methods to lessen your chance of being targeted. This includes locking the doors and parking in areas that are well-lit and using additional security systems such as pedal locks and steering wheel. Certain automakers, like Kia and Hyundai are taking further steps to improve security. Certain automakers have developed specialized technology to prevent thieves from replicating the signal of a keyfob. These keys only function when the owner opens it, which prevents thieves from using devices that replicate the signal when the owner is asleep. This is a welcome improvement, but it's not enough to prevent all car thefts.

kia car keys's smart keys feature an integrated radio transmitter that allows you to lock and unlock your car from some distance. They also let you remotely open the trunk. They can also shut off the ignition by pressing the button on the handle for the driver's door on the side. However, this feature is not available on all vehicles.

Burgh Locksmiths are able offer replacement Kia key for all Kia models, starting in 1998. The keys contain a microchip, which communicates with the car's security system to verify that the key is genuine and programmed. The first chip that was used in kia sportage smart key cars was one that was a Texas crypto 4D type 13, however, later models are equipped that have rolling codes.
